Feynman on the "Why" Question
If you want a brilliant exploration of this very topic, it is worth checking out Richard Feynman talking about it. You can find him discussing it in this video: https://youtu.be/Q1lL-hXO27Q
Here is a small excerpt from the video:
"Why did she slip on the ice?" Well, ice is slippery. Everybody knows that, no problem. But you ask why is ice slippery? That's kinda curious. Ice is extremely slippery. It's very interesting. You say, how does it work? You could either say, "I'm satisfied that you've answered me. Ice is slippery; that explains it," or you could go on and say, "Why is ice slippery?" and then you're involved with something, because there aren't many things as slippery as ice. It's not very hard to get greasy stuff, but that's sort of wet and slimy. But a solid that's so slippery? Because it is, in the case of ice, when you stand on it (they say) momentarily the pressure melts the ice a little bit so you get a sort of instantaneous water surface on which you're slipping. Why on ice and not on other things? Because water expands when it freezes, so the pressure tries to undo the expansion and melts it. It's capable of melting, but other substances get cracked when they're freezing, and when you push them they're satisfied to be solid.
Why does water expand when it freezes and other substances don't? I'm not answering your question, but I'm telling you how difficult the why question is. You have to know what it is that you're permitted to understand and allow to be understood and known, and what it is you're not. You'll notice, in this example, that the more I ask why, the deeper a thing is, the more interesting it gets. We could even go further and say, "Why did she fall down when she slipped?" It has to do with gravity, involves all the planets and everything else. Nevermind! It goes on and on.
Pretty deep, right? The sort of thing that sends our brains on a full merry-go-round. The beauty of the "why" question is that it works at whatever depth you are willing to go. There is no single stopping point, which is exactly what makes it so powerful. Those questions can lead to the realization or the discovery of some of the most beautiful aspects of this universe — from the simplest everyday moment to the furthest reaches of science.
No matter what type of question it is, ask if you want to know. Curiosity is one of the most human things we have, and every great understanding begins with someone daring to ask why.
